Culture Ireland is the state agency for the promotion of Irish arts worldwide, working under the aegis of the Minister for Tourism, Culture and Sport. 

Culture Ireland creates and supports opportunities for Irish artists to present their work at strategic international festivals, venues, showcases and arts markets.

The agency comprises a board appointed by the Minister and an executive staff led by Eugene Downes, the Chief Executive.

John GerrardCulture Ireland announces grant awards and strategic focus on United States in 2011

Culture Ireland awarded in excess of €430,000 to over 70 projects which will see Irish artists present work in 26 countries, across 5 continents. Culture Ireland also confirmed a strategic focus on the US in 2011. Read more.

Culture Ireland congratulates Druid on Edinburgh Fringe First

Druid's production of Enda Walsh's new play Penelope, presented as part of Culture Ireland's Edinburgh showcase, has been awarded a Fringe First. Read more. Click here to read Ireland at Edinburgh brochure.
